-
- vscode怎么用git查看差异预览_vscode查看git文件改动差异预览的方法
- VisualStudioCode提供多种方式预览Git文件差异:首先通过资源管理器面板点击修改文件进入差异视图;其次使用内置diff编辑器对比旧版与新版,以红绿标记删改内容;再者可通过命令面板执行“CompareActiveFilewith...”快速比较版本;最后可分别查看暂存区与工作区的差异,确保提交前准确核对更改。
- VSCode . 开发工具 282 2025-11-10 16:01:02
-
- sublime如何安装Package Control_Sublime插件管理器安装与配置教程
- 首先通过快捷键Ctrl+`打开Sublime控制台,粘贴官方Python安装脚本并运行,成功后状态栏会显示“PackageControl:Installing…”,重启软件并在CommandPalette中搜索InstallPackage,若能正常弹出插件列表则表示安装成功;注意网络连接、代理设置及使用正版Sublime以避免异常。
- sublime . 开发工具 514 2025-11-10 15:54:03
-
- sublime怎么修改侧边栏字体大小_sublime调整侧边栏字体大小教程
- SublimeText可通过自定义主题文件修改侧边栏字体大小:先复制默认主题文件并重命名,再编辑该文件添加"sidebar_label"类的"font.size"属性,最后在用户设置中指定使用新主题即可生效。
- sublime . 开发工具 721 2025-11-10 15:40:03
-
- sublime怎么让查找结果在新标签页中显示_sublime搜索结果标签化显示技巧
- SublimeText默认搜索结果在底部面板,可通过复制粘贴至新建标签页实现标签化查看;2.安装PackageControl及插件如AdvancedNewFile或SearchHighlight可增强搜索体验;3.进阶用户可录制宏并绑定快捷键,自动化创建带标题的搜索结果标签页,提升效率。
- sublime . 开发工具 177 2025-11-10 15:26:02
-
- 告别手动编号的烦恼:如何使用PimcoreNumberSequenceGenerator轻松管理订单和优惠码
- 在开发业务系统时,管理唯一的订单号、客户编号或生成安全的优惠码常常令人头疼。传统的手动或简单自增方式不仅效率低下,还可能导致数据冲突和业务逻辑混乱。pimcore/number-sequence-generator这个Composer包提供了一个强大而灵活的解决方案。它能自动生成连续的序列号,确保在并发环境下的唯一性,也能轻松创建各种类型(数字或字母数字)的随机码,彻底解放了开发者,让编号管理变得前所未有的简单和可靠。
- composer . 开发工具 671 2025-11-10 15:03:25
-
- 如何在VSCode中运行HTML文件?
- 使用LiveServer插件可轻松在VSCode中运行HTML文件,安装后右键选择“OpenwithLiveServer”即可在浏览器中实时预览,保存自动刷新;也可直接通过资源管理器双击HTML文件用默认浏览器打开,适合快速查看。
- VSCode . 开发工具 867 2025-11-10 15:03:03
-
- 如何解决PHP异步操作的性能瓶颈?GuzzlePromises助你实现非阻塞编程!
- 在PHP开发中,处理耗时I/O操作(如多个API请求、数据库查询)常常导致程序阻塞和性能下降。传统同步模式难以应对高并发场景,导致用户体验不佳。本文将介绍如何利用Composer安装GuzzlePromises库,并通过其Promise/A+实现,将复杂的异步流程转化为清晰、可管理的代码。我们将探讨Promise的链式调用、错误处理及同步等待机制,展示它如何有效提升应用响应速度,优化用户体验,并简化异步编程的复杂性。
- composer . 开发工具 595 2025-11-10 15:00:30
-
- sublime写vue项目需要哪些插件_sublime前端开发与Vue插件推荐
- 答案:通过安装VueSyntaxHighlight实现语法高亮,配合Babel支持现代JS语法;使用Emmet和AutoFileName提升代码编写效率;结合JsPrettier与SublimeLinter集成Prettier、ESLint等工具完成格式化与校验,从而在SublimeText中构建高效Vue开发环境。
- sublime . 开发工具 1032 2025-11-10 14:53:20
-
- composer 1.x和composer 2.x有哪些主要区别
- Composer2.x相比1.x性能提升2-10倍,支持并行下载、更快的autoload生成和更高效的依赖解析。
- composer . 开发工具 510 2025-11-10 14:45:03
-
- 如何解决PHP应用集成MailerLite邮件营销API的痛点,并使用其官方SDK提升开发效率
- 在构建现代PHP应用时,与邮件营销服务(如MailerLite)的集成是常见需求。然而,直接操作复杂的RESTfulAPI,涉及手动构建HTTP请求、处理认证、解析JSON响应及管理错误,不仅耗时费力,还极易出错。这种低效的集成方式严重拖慢了开发进度。本文将带你走出困境,介绍如何利用Composer轻松引入MailerLite官方PHPSDK,它将繁琐的API交互抽象化,让你能以简洁的代码实现订阅者管理、活动创建与调度等功能。通过SDK,我们不仅能大幅提升开发效率,降低维护成本,还能确保集成稳定
- composer . 开发工具 369 2025-11-10 14:44:32
-
- VS Code任务系统:自动化构建与脚本执行
- VSCode任务系统可自动化构建、编译和脚本执行,通过配置.tasks.json文件定义任务,支持一键运行TypeScript编译、npm脚本等,提升开发效率。
- VSCode . 开发工具 521 2025-11-10 14:35:33
-
- composer怎么查看当前使用的镜像地址_Composer查看当前镜像源方法
- 要查看当前Composer使用的镜像地址,可执行composerconfig-l|greprepo.packagist.org,该命令显示项目或全局配置中Packagist镜像设置,若输出repositories.packagist.org.url为https://mirrors.aliyun.com/composer/等非官方地址,则表明已使用国内镜像源。
- composer . 开发工具 924 2025-11-10 14:31:02
-
- 如何优雅地解决PHP生成SEO友好URL(Slug)的难题?EasySlugger助你轻松搞定!
- 在Web开发中,为文章、产品等内容生成简洁、SEO友好的URL(通常称为Slug)是一个常见而又关键的需求。然而,当原始内容包含中文、日文等UTF-8字符或特殊符号时,手动处理往往效率低下且容易出错,导致URL不规范,影响用户体验和搜索引擎优化。本文将介绍如何利用Composer安装并使用javiereguiluz/easyslugger库,它提供了一系列强大且易用的Slug生成器,完美解决了这一难题。通过它,我们可以轻松将复杂字符串转化为规范的URL片段,大大提升开发效率和网站的SEO表现。
- composer . 开发工具 799 2025-11-10 14:04:01
-
- 告别IbexaDXP环境排查难题:ibexa/system-info助你一眼看透系统真相
- 作为一名IbexaDXP的系统管理员或支持工程师,你是否曾为生产环境的疑难杂症焦头烂额?手动检查PHP版本、扩展、数据库连接、甚至核心配置,耗时耗力且极易出错。当问题紧急时,这种低效的排查方式无疑是雪上加霜。今天,我们将探讨如何利用IbexaDXP内置的ibexa/system-info组件,告别盲人摸象式的排查困境,实现对系统环境的快速、精准洞察,大幅提升故障解决与系统维护的效率。
- composer . 开发工具 816 2025-11-10 14:02:02
-
- 告别PHP应用与AWS交互的“黑盒”:使用OpenTelemetryAWSContrib轻松实现全面可观测性
- 在构建基于云的PHP应用时,与AWS服务的频繁交互是常态。然而,如何深入理解这些服务调用的性能表现、快速定位潜在问题,并获得整个分布式系统端到端的视图,往往是开发者面临的巨大挑战。传统的日志分析往往碎片化且缺乏关联性,难以提供清晰的洞察。本文将介绍OpenTelemetryAWSContrib,一个强大的Composer包,它能帮助你的PHP应用自动为AWSSDK调用添加分布式追踪能力,从而彻底解决这些“黑盒”问题,让你的系统行为一目了然,显著提升开发与运维效率。
- composer . 开发工具 230 2025-11-10 13:56:01
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是
